چکیده انگلیسی

Power factor is well defined in sinusoidal situations, however, in the presence of harmonics, different power factors exist and they may provide different values in which case, evaluation becomes problematic. In Morsi and El-Hawary (2008) [1], [2] and [3], fuzzy systems have been used by the authors to develop a representative index that quantifies the power factor in different operating conditions including sinusoidal and non-sinusoidal situations. However, since different fuzzy operators can be used in the fuzzy system, which will affect the measured output power factor index, this paper investigates the implementation of different fuzzy operators when applied to the developed fuzzy system-based power factor evaluation, in different operating conditions. It is found that the use of the ‘algebraic product-sum’ operation offers the most suitable connection method, while the ‘algebraic product’ is the most preferred as an implication method and the ‘maximum’ operation is best suited for the aggregation operation. These combinations offer the most suitable means for establishing a representative power factor under non-sinusoidal conditions with the least computational burden.
